Initial Prototyping
3M started this particular phase by making stereolithography (SLA) designs using its in-house SLA gear. Flood SLA function was found in order to Landscape Technologies. The SLA prototypes were used through engineers as well as industrial creative designers to check fit and type. Exactly the same prototypes were utilised through 3M product packaging engineers to create conceptual mock-ups of product packaging. Additionally they made superb resources with regard to ergonomic as well as functionality research.
To imitate the actual gentle below mat of the sanding device, Landscape used PolyJet(TM) rapid prototyping technologies. PolyJet was chosen since it can use possibly of two soft-durometer (a hardness measurement) materials that can be set you back acquire comparable high quality parts as SLA technology. TangoBlack, the material with a score of 61 on the Shore The durometer scale, had been the very best fit. Within times Landscape could provide 3M using their simulated soft-durometer below pads for more testing.
The underside mat for the hands sander was prototyped utilizing TangoBlack material from the Polyjet technology. This material is really a Sixty one Shoreline A material that imitates the properties of santoprene.
Simultaneously, a gripping/tensioning mechanism for that sanding press was being created. At this point, the sub-assemblies had been merged right into a refined group of CAD databases. Additional SLA parts were created to assess the brand new mechanisms. Along with every brand new model, they could investigate latest features in the design. Because these quick prototype parts could be created cost-effectively within hours rather than days or even days, they had the ability to research complicated forms and details in a method difficult utilizing traditional machining and fabrication techniques. In some cases several iterations had been generated in one or even 2 days.

Second-Generation Rapid Prototypes: More Realistic Simulations
In the 2nd era from the prototypes, 3M required the actual joint perform as well as materials properties to be simulated more reasonably. After a few design changes had been designed to the actual CAD information, Landscape Systems supplied 3M with a Fused Depositing Custom modeling rendering (FDM) model.
The FDM part, produced from extruded dark ABS, permitted for additional robust testing and supplied comparable specified materials properties in pounds as well as strength since the last component would have. This model was able to manage a number of tests that allowed 3M to modify their design before manufacturing tooling was launched.
